In my region, paper mills call them tow motors,” warehouses may refer to them as stackers,” and builders tend to use telehandlers” in lieu of rough terrain forklifts.” OSHA uses the all-encompassing phrase powered industrial trucks,” or PITs, when referring to forklifts in its 1910.178 standard.

While standard forklifts require aisles that are at least eleven feet wide to operate, a narrow aisle (NA) forklift can work in spaces that are 8 to 10 feet wide, while very narrow aisle forklifts (VNA) can operate in aisles as narrow as 6 feet.
